Team Administrative Assistant

How does the role impact the organization?

The primary role of the Administrative Assistant is to support one of the high producing Advisory teams ensuring the clients receive outstanding service.
The candidate is a self-motivated individual with exceptional administrative skills and a dependable nature. The candidate will bring to the role an ability to work within deadlines both independently and as part of a team, proven effective time management skills, with a focus on customer service and a willingness to go above and beyond what is asked. This is an entry level position within a supportive team environment whose contributions are important to the success of the client relationship with the Financial Advisor, and to the success of team as a whole. The candidate should be drawing on previous experience as an Administrative Assistant or in a financial services firm, or upon a degree/diploma within Business Administration. They must have meticulous attention to detail, possess a positive attitude, and have exceptional interpersonal skills. The successful candidate must also be responsible, confident, self-motivated, and a team player.

What is the position responsible for?

  • Provide accurate, organized and efficient administrative support to two advisors on a fast-paced growing team;
  • Be responsible for and support the team with paperwork & manage head office correspondence;
  • Basic financial administrative duties including sending funds, address changes, client account agreement updates and other documents in the everyday management of clients financial accounts;
  • Communicate internally with various operational and administration departments;
  • Process and follow up on security transactions and transfers;
  • Assist during tax reporting season, liaising with tax professionals & clients to provide details, slips and updates as required;
  • Handle incoming and outgoing phone calls with clients and respond to requests for information;
  • Schedule and organize client meetings;
  • Maintain Financial Advisor files;
  • Perform general office duties; and
  • Prepare for client meetings
